Transaction 6571656bb2bcf00fc850bccbffe8a41d58397060ba72443e1100ef5f7e5d90e2

1 Input
2 Outputs
  • 6571656bb2bcf00fc850bccbffe8a41d58397060ba72443e1100ef5f7e5d90e2:0
  • value  585229
    address  36X6MeFSg5PQ8E4NLDJSV7znz5M4vAwV9S
  • 6571656bb2bcf00fc850bccbffe8a41d58397060ba72443e1100ef5f7e5d90e2:1
  • value  234962
    address  bc1qap9qx2v632dujthqk53qekc6p5y7yqg00myflf